Youth Minister meets GCC youth delegations participating in Youth City 2030 programmes

Manama, Aug. 12 (BNA): Rawan bint Najeeb Tawfiqi, Minister of Youth Affairs, met with GCC delegations participating in the programmes of the GCC Youth Empowerment Committee at Youth City 2030, welcoming the participants and commending their engagement in the programmes and activities hosted by the city.

 

The minister highlighted the opportunities provided by Youth City 2030 for learning, development and the exchange of expertise and experiences among GCC youth, affirming that Bahrain remains committed to supporting GCC joint action and strengthening cooperation among the GCC countries.

 

She noted that this commitment comes as part of the comprehensive development process led by His Majesty King Hamad bin Isa Al Khalifa, and highlighted the directives of His Royal Highness Prince Salman bin Hamad Al Khalifa, Crown Prince and Prime Minister, which reflect Bahrain’s commitment to strengthening GCC cooperation and integration.

 

The minister also affirmed that the support and attention of His Highness Shaikh Nasser bin Hamad Al Khalifa, HM the King’s Representative for Humanitarian Work and Youth Affairs and Chairman of the Supreme Council for Youth and Sports, provide important impetus to efforts to empower young people, enhance their participation in GCC joint action, and expand opportunities for communication and cooperation among GCC youth.

 

She highlighted the role of youth as a key pillar of development, stressing the importance of continuing to provide programmes and initiatives that enhance their capabilities, develop their skills and open wider avenues for cooperation and innovation, contributing to preparing a generation capable of advancing achievements and development.

 

The minister affirmed that the participation of GCC delegations in Youth City 2030 reflects the depth of the fraternal ties among GCC youth and the shared commitment to strengthening communication, exchanging expertise and experiences, and benefiting from successful models and practices in youth empowerment.

 

She also reviewed the delegations experiences and impressions of the programmes they attended, commending their engagement and keenness to benefit from the specialised training and knowledge opportunities provided by Youth City 2030.

 

For their part, members of the GCC delegations expressed their appreciation to Bahrain and the Ministry of Youth Affairs for hosting their participation, commending the quality programmes and enriching experiences offered by Youth City 2030 and their contribution to developing young people’s skills and strengthening communication among them.  They stressed the importance of continuing such initiatives in support of GCC youth cooperation.
